Renters’ Rights Training

Online

Has it been hard for you to keep up with the constant changes brought about by COVID-19, especially those involving housing? You’re not alone!

Please join LGBTQ Allyship and Ingersoll Gender Center for a presentation on Renters’ Rights in Seattle and King County on Tuesday, May 19th from 3p-4p PST.

We will be sharing information on LGBTQ housing history, the Landlord/Tenant Act and Fair Housing Law, how to exercise your renters' rights(especially during COVID-19), and more. Come learn about our resources and support available to our communities and get some answers on dealing with housing during the COVID-19 pandemic.

LGBTQ+ Workers, COVID-19, and Unemployment Benefits

Online

This webinar is for any LGBTQ+ worker whose job has been impacted by COVID-19 and seeks information about unemployment benefits. Join us if you work for a private business, you are an independent contractor, or you are not sure if your employment is eligible for benefits. We will cover how to access benefits if:

  • you have experienced job loss or a reduction in hours;
  • your benefits have been affected because of a name/gender mismatch;
  • you have experienced anti-LGBTQ+ discrimination or illegal behavior and are not sure you can continue working;
  • you worked as a legal sex worker or adult entertainer and are not sure if you are eligible for benefits; or
  • you have been unable to access unemployment due to a prior overpayment.
  • Speakers from the Unemployment Law Project, QLaw Foundation, LGBTQ+ Legal Clinic, and Ingersoll Gender Center will answer questions about eligibility for state unemployment insurance benefits, expanded eligibility under the CARES Act, how to navigate common application problems, and what to do if your application has been denied.
